time(2) time(2)
NAME time - get time SYNOPSIS #include <time.h> time_t time((long*)0) time_t time(tloc) time_t *tloc; DESCRIPTION time returns the value of time in seconds since 00:00:00 GMT, January 1, 1970. If tloc (taken as an integer) is nonzero, the return value is also stored in the location to which tloc points. RETURN VALUE On successful completion, time returns the value of time. Otherwise, a value of -1 is returned and errno is set to in- dicate the error. ERRORS time will fail if the following is true [EFAULT] tloc points to an illegal address. SEE ALSO date(1), gettimeofday(2), stime(2), ctime(3). April, 1990 1
